List building should be a key step from the start. Think about it this way - you put all that effort into getting someone there in the first place, what would you prefer to do? Do it again and get more strangers. Or add some list building methods, and bring back pre-warmed or even excited prospects.
Hi, speaking as someone who's in the U.S., I would hesitate to enter...it looks a little "scammy" because of the way some of the copy is written. It reminds me of the contest scam emails that go around every so often. I don't know who your target audience is, but if you're hoping for response from the U.S., then this needs to be in the form of a conversion-focused landing page written in standard English. (I specialize in writing such things, but I'll refrain from flogging my services since I just got here.) Any time you're trying to create a response, your copy should be written in direct response format...and this is more in the form of an article. The copy needs to clearly answer these questions: What is going on? Why are you having a contest? What do I have to do to enter? What are you going to do with my private information? When are you announcing the winner? You say "come here daily"...is that all I have to do? How will I get the award if I win? How do I get more chances to win? As written, it's overly wordy in some parts, and lacking detail in others. Seriously, hire a direct response copywriter. It's our job to make people do stuff.
